GELO Timber Industries today

With a yearly cut of 250 000 solid cubic meters and very modern sawmill technology;

GELO is one of the biggest and most renowned timber processing factories in Germany today.

The company’s area has grown to 200 000 sq. m.

The logs are decorticated mechanically on a high-performance lumberyard.

Measurement and sorting of the logs is also computerized. Eventually two gantry cranes haul these logs for processing.

Mass products as well as timber of every dimension and length is produced in a profile chipping plant that boasts of a flexible infeed with a special and unique technology.

Thanks to its 8 high-temperature drying facilities and 1 vacuum-drying installation, GELO is able to dry all kinds of timber to any desirable level of final moisture content before processing.

Wood is processed and tagged with different profiles on 4 flexible planing machines in the internal planing plants.

GELO’s line of KVH-products is one of the most innovative and fastest in central Europe.

Around 100 m3 KVH according to list or KVH-beams up to 15.50 m are produced in the proverbial GELO quality.

All trimmed timber can be offered with dipping impregnation also. We work with only chromate free protection salts that are durable as well as eco-friendly. More information can be found in our Service Area.

Our wood chips and sawdust go directly either to the paper and pulp industry as raw materials or to riding stalls and board manufacturing factories.

GELO-timber is transported the world over with trucks and ships. With the help of our reliable movers, we are able to supply the customers at a short notice.

GELO’s more than 80 qualified and competent employees attend to purchase, processing and sales of timber and to intensive customer service.

Trainees are educated diligently in all sectors of the company and are prepared for a secure future.

The owner of GELO is Christian Küspert. His son Wolf-Christian supports him in operative management since 2003.
